diff --git a/src/main/java/com/Acrobot/ChestShop/ChestShop.java b/src/main/java/com/Acrobot/ChestShop/ChestShop.java index d7248b4..f64db86 100644 --- a/src/main/java/com/Acrobot/ChestShop/ChestShop.java +++ b/src/main/java/com/Acrobot/ChestShop/ChestShop.java @@ -146,6 +146,7 @@ public class ChestShop extends JavaPlugin { } public void loadConfig() { + Properties.setup(); Configuration.pairFileAndClass(loadFile("config.yml"), Properties.class); Configuration.pairFileAndClass(loadFile("local.yml"), Messages.class); diff --git a/src/main/java/com/Acrobot/ChestShop/Configuration/Properties.java b/src/main/java/com/Acrobot/ChestShop/Configuration/Properties.java index 98698bf..679bcd1 100644 --- a/src/main/java/com/Acrobot/ChestShop/Configuration/Properties.java +++ b/src/main/java/com/Acrobot/ChestShop/Configuration/Properties.java @@ -12,9 +12,7 @@ import java.math.BigDecimal; import java.util.Arrays; import java.util.Collection; import java.util.EnumSet; -import java.util.HashSet; import java.util.LinkedHashSet; -import java.util.List; import java.util.Set; import java.util.logging.Level; @@ -22,7 +20,8 @@ import java.util.logging.Level; * @author Acrobot */ public class Properties { - static { + + public static void setup() { Configuration.registerParser("StringSet", new ValueParser(){ public Object parseToJava(Object object) { if (object instanceof Collection) {